Sendmail Risk Assessment Program Allows Global Organizations to Protect Customer Privacy Data and Intellectual Property
New Program Demonstrates Actual Risks Occurring in Outbound Email
Emeryville, Calif. – December 06, 2006 – Sendmail, Inc., the leading global provider of trusted messaging, today announced the availability of its Risk Assessment Program to benchmark actual security and compliance risks found in outbound email. Global enterprises are using the Sendmail Risk Assessment Program to discover the gap between their company’s compliance policies – for example their customer’s privacy policy statement – and what is actually occurring in outbound email where an estimated 80 percent of compliance violations occur. The result is the ability to close the gap by enforcing compliance and security policies without impacting email quality of service or replacing email infrastructure.

There are more than 275 million corporate mailboxes in use and over 130 billion emails sent each day (Radicati Group). With over 60 percent of the world’s email being routed through Sendmail, the company warns the potential compliance and security risks associated with electronic disclosure are immense. In recent research sponsored by Sendmail (see: http://www.sendmail.com/company/news/20061113/?x=51 Report), only 43 percent of companies surveyed had a solution in place to stop outbound compliance threats. The Sendmail Risk Assessment Program is the first step an organization can take to prevent compliance violations in outbound email without replacing their current email infrastructure.

The Sendmail Risk Assessment Program Process

The Sendmail Risk Assessment program is designed to measure an organization’s current compliance risk and begin to plan a long-term risk management strategy that will protect its brand, reputation and competitive advantage – without impacting the quality of service within the email infrastructure.

“We found the process extremely helpful in determining where potential risks existed within our messaging infrastructure and Sendmail quickly outlined key areas for improvement,” said a messaging architect within a large governmental defense organization, who, for security reasons, remains anonymous. “The Sendmail team was knowledgeable and extremely sensitive about our stringent security requirements. They helped us identify ways to stop confidential information from leaving our network in email. In the end, we trusted Sendmail’s recommendations because the program demonstrated their expertise with our legal department. We are now able to enforce the protection of confidential data in our high volume messaging environment and we didn’t have to replace or compromise our email infrastructure.”

During the assessment process, Sendmail pinpoints risks within the areas of security, and compliance, utilizing its 25-year heritage building messaging and operational best practices. The entire process is non-intrusive and is driven through an interactive workshop session with the key security, compliance and messaging decision stakeholders followed by a 48-hour analysis period that tracks the real compliance risks taking place in outbound email. Following the 48-hour analysis period, Sendmail’s findings and a roadmap to remediation follow in an executive report highlighting the violations and addressing the critical compliance, security and business stakeholder requirements. Once a company understands their risk, they can begin to apply policy management to begin preventing the inappropriate disclosure of sensitive data without making significant changes to their email infrastructure.
